Diff Report
Run #565918537d922: XHProf Run (Namespace=drupal-perf-joelpittet)
vs.
Run #5659186b7d6e0: XHProf Run (Namespace=drupal-perf-joelpittet)
Tip
Click a function name below to drill down.

Regression/Improvement summary for Drupal\Core\Routing\RouteProvider::getRoutesByNames

Drupal\Core\Routing\RouteProvider::getRoutesByNamesRun #565918537d922Run #5659186b7d6e0DiffDiff%
Number of Function Calls10,600 10,600 0 0.0%
Incl. Wall Time (microsec)1,671,217 1,699,129 27,912 1.7%
Incl. Wall Time (microsec) per call 158 160 3 1.7%
Excl. Wall Time (microsec)76,716 76,957 241 0.3%
Incl. MemUse (bytes)26,243,264 26,470,456 227,192 0.9%
Incl. MemUse (bytes) per call 2,476 2,497 21 0.9%
Excl. MemUse (bytes)-7,193,792 -7,192,272 1,520 0.0%
Incl. PeakMemUse (bytes)45,667,536 46,122,976 455,440 1.0%
Incl. PeakMemUse (bytes) per call 4,308 4,351 43 1.0%
Excl. PeakMemUse (bytes)0 0 0 N/A%

Parent/Child Regression/Improvement report for Drupal\Core\Routing\RouteProvider::getRoutesByNames [View Callgraph Diff]


Function NameCalls DiffCalls
Diff%
Incl. Wall
Diff
(microsec)
IWall
Diff%
Incl.
MemUse
Diff
(bytes)
IMemUse
Diff%
Incl.
PeakMemUse
Diff
(bytes)
IPeakMemUse
Diff%
Current Function
Drupal\Core\Routing\RouteProvider::getRoutesByNames0 N/A% 27,912 6.0% 227,192 14.6% 455,440 29.8%
Exclusive Metrics Diff for Current Function241 0.9% 1,520 0.7% 0 0.0%
Parent function
Drupal\Core\Routing\RouteProvider::getRouteByName0 N/A% 27,912 100.0% 227,192 100.0% 455,440 100.0%
Child functions
Drupal\Core\Routing\RouteProvider::preLoadRoutes0 N/A% 22,668 81.2% 7,360 3.2% 435,616 95.6%
unserialize0 N/A% 4,454 16.0% 213,432 93.9% 19,824 4.4%
array_intersect_key0 N/A% 458 1.6% 5,264 2.3% 0 0.0%
array_flip0 N/A% 91 0.3% -384 -0.2% 0 0.0%